3 Types of Construction Contracts: Their Pros and Cons for Owners and Contractors Fixed Price. The most common type of contract is the fixed price contract, also known as the lump sum or stipulated sum contract. Cost-Plus Fee. Unit Price.
These five essential elements of a construction contract can result in major vulnerabilities if overlooked: Full Name, Address, and Signatures of Both Parties. Scope of Work. Project Cost and Payment Terms. Schedule of Work. Authority.

The contract should include the total price, when payments will be made, and whether there is a cancellation penalty. You should expect to make a down payment on any home improvement job. That down payment should never exceed 10 percent of the contract price or $1,000, whichever is less. These are some of the most common and important construction documents for building projects of all kinds. 1: Construction Agreement. 2: General Conditions. 3: Special Conditions. 4: Scope of Work (SOW) 5: Drawings. 7: Bill of Quantities. 9: Schedule of Values. 10: Cost Estimate.
What are the three rules of construction? Three rules generally accepted in construction of contracts are the plain meaning rule, the enforceability rule and the interpretation that favors the non-drafting party.
Construction Contract Documents are the written documents that define the roles, responsibilities, and Work under the construction Contract, and are legally-binding on the parties (Owner and Contractor).
